I started out with the Game Master character. Over the session, it created an NPC that I liked and decided to make its own character. So I created it using the "Unknown" preset, called it Rya and made a Rentry lore page for her.

I inserted her into the Game Master thread and it worked pretty well. I understand that the GM character has its own lore and memories. But how do memories and lore work for Rya?

  • Can it save things and remember them for RP in separate thread?
  • Does the AI write on the Rentry/text file?
  • Can I use the same Rentry/text file on different characters? I was thinking about uploading a text file on the GM that Rya shares so it could move with her to other threads.

Now the GM Character:

  • Can it reference generators?
  • I would like it to use some guidelines so I modified its instructions (pasted below). Or would this be better entered in a lore page?
  • I was thinking that I would write my characters normal message plus a roll: /user I search for treasure (I roll a fail, interpret the Oracle results: Clash/Balance)

Here is my draft of the GM Instructions: The Game Master will now write a 1-2 paragraph reply with the consequences of the player's chosen action.

The Game Master is exceptionally skilled at leading the player on an interesting, engaging, non-cliché, and immersive adventure. It will let the player make interesting choices.

The following response will NOT move the story along too fast—it will stay mostly in the present moment and describe the immediate consequences of the player's actions. It will not take actions on behalf of the player. It will only describe the consequences of their actions.

The Game Master will use the following system to judge a scene: Strong Hit means {{char}} will succeed and is in control of the current situation; Weak Hit means {{char}} succeeds but with complications or at a cost; Miss means {{char}} faces a dramatic turn of events, not necessarily a failure.
